pip3 - Python 包的包管理器
概要
pip3 <命令> [选项]
描述
pip3 是 PyPA 推荐的 Python 包管理器
选项
-h, --help
显示帮助。
(环境变量:PIP_HELP)
--debug
让未处理的异常从主子程序外部传播出来,而不是将它们记录到 stderr。
(环境变量:PIP_DEBUG)
--isolated
以隔离模式运行 pip,忽略环境变量和用户配置。
(环境变量:PIP_ISOLATED)
--require-virtualenv
允许 pip 仅在虚拟环境中运行;否则,退出并显示错误。
(环境变量:PIP_REQUIRE_VIRTUALENV, PIP_REQUIRE_VENV)
--python <python>
使用指定的 Python 解释器运行 pip。
(环境变量:PIP_PYTHON)
-v, --verbose
提供更多输出。选项是累加的,最多可以使用 3 次。
(环境变量:PIP_VERBOSE)
-V, --version
显示版本并退出。
(环境变量:PIP_VERSION)
-q, --quiet
提供更少的输出。选项是累加的,最多可以使用 3 次(对应于 WARNING、ERROR 和 CRITICAL 记录级别)。
(环境变量:PIP_QUIET)
--log <path>
指向一个追加的详细日志的路径。
(环境变量:PIP_LOG, PIP_LOG_FILE, PIP_LOCAL_LOG)
--no-input
禁用提示输入。
(环境变量:PIP_NO_INPUT)
--keyring-provider <keyring_provider>
如果允许用户输入,则启用通过 keyring 库的凭据查找。指定要使用哪种机制 [auto, disabled, import, subprocess]。(默认值:auto)
(环境变量:PIP_KEYRING_PROVIDER)
--proxy <proxy>
指定采用 scheme://[user:passwd@]proxy.server:port 形式的代理。
(环境变量:PIP_PROXY)
--retries <retries>
建立新 HTTP 连接的最大尝试次数。(默认值:5)
(环境变量:PIP_RETRIES)
--timeout <sec>
设置套接字超时时间(默认 15 秒)。
(环境变量:PIP_TIMEOUT, PIP_DEFAULT_TIMEOUT)
--exists-action <action>
路径已存在时的默认操作:(s)witch、(i)gnore、(w)ipe、(b)ackup、(a)bort。
(环境变量:PIP_EXISTS_ACTION)
--trusted-host <hostname>
将此主机或主机:端口对标记为受信任,即使它没有有效的或任何 HTTPS。
(环境变量:PIP_TRUSTED_HOST)
--cert <path>
指向 PEM 编码的 CA 证书捆绑包的路径。如果提供,则覆盖默认设置。有关更多信息,请参阅 pip 文档中的“SSL 证书验证”。
(环境变量:PIP_CERT)
--client-cert <path>
指向 SSL 客户端证书的路径,该文件包含 PEM 格式的私钥和证书。
(环境变量:PIP_CLIENT_CERT)
--cache-dir <dir>
将缓存数据存储在 <dir> 中。
(环境变量:PIP_CACHE_DIR)
--no-cache-dir
禁用缓存。
(环境变量:PIP_NO_CACHE_DIR)
--disable-pip-version-check
定期检查 PyPI,以确定是否有新的 pip 版本可供下载。与 --no-index 结合使用时,则禁用。
(环境变量:PIP_DISABLE_PIP_VERSION_CHECK)
--no-color
禁止彩色输出。
(环境变量:PIP_NO_COLOR)
--use-feature <feature>
启用新的功能,这些功能可能与旧版本不兼容。
(环境变量:PIP_USE_FEATURE)
--use-deprecated <feature>
启用已弃用的功能,这些功能将来将被删除。
(环境变量:PIP_USE_DEPRECATED)
--resume-retries <resume_retries>
恢复或重新启动不完整下载的最大尝试次数。(默认值:5)
(环境变量:PIP_RESUME_RETRIES)
命令
pip3-install(1)
安装包。
pip3-download(1)
下载包。
pip3-uninstall(1)
卸载包。
pip3-freeze(1)
以 requirements 格式输出已安装的包。
pip3-lock(1)
为 requirements 及其依赖项生成锁定文件。
pip3-list(1)
列出已安装的包。
pip3-show(1)
显示有关已安装包的信息。
pip3-check(1)
验证已安装的包是否具有兼容的依赖项。
pip3-search(1)
在 PyPI 中搜索包。
pip3-wheel(1)
从您的 requirements 构建 wheel。
pip3-hash(1)
计算包存档的哈希值。
pip3-help(1)
显示 pip 命令的帮助信息。
作者
pip 开发人员
版权
pip 开发人员